Dri­ve Elec­tric Col­orado presents an EVs in Col­orado report.

Using data from the Col­orado Ener­gy Office’s EV Dash­board and the Alter­na­tive Fuel­ing Sta­tion Loca­tor from the Depart­ment of Ener­gy, below is the most cur­rent and accu­rate sales data for EVs and charg­ing data by coun­ty, make/model, and elec­tric vehi­cle type.

As of June 1, 2022, there were 56,010 EVs on the road in Col­orado, up from 49,884 EVs since March 1, 2022. Of this total, 39,602 were bat­tery elec­tric vehi­cles (BEV) and 16,408 were plug-in hybrid elec­tric vehi­cles (PHEV).

Key points from the most cur­rent data since March 1, 2022:

  • Elec­tric vehi­cle adop­tion was up 5% (+6,126 EVs) in only three months from March 1, 2022.
  • Top sell­ing elec­tric car makes: 
    • Tes­la
    • Nis­san
    • Chevro­let
    • BMW
    • Toy­ota
    • Jeep

There are cur­rent­ly 4,087 total pub­lic charg­ing ports avail­able in Col­orado, up 172 ports from March 1, 2022. With­in this total, 3,448 of these are Lev­el 2 charg­ers, and 639 of these Lev­el 3/DC fast chargers.

Charge­Point Net­work has pro­vid­ed most of these Lev­el 2 ports (1,857) and Tes­la owns the most DC fast charg­er ports (267). From quar­ter 2 of 2021 (Jan­u­ary 4 – June 3), there was an aver­age of 1,027 active charg­ing sta­tions with 149,507 hours of charg­ing over 81,259 charg­ing ses­sions. Break­ing it down by coun­ty and vehi­cle mod­el, here are the top mod­els and top coun­ties where EVs are on the road:

Denver County

  • 9,189 elec­tric vehi­cles (6,531 BEVs and 2,658 PHEVs)
  • 85 EV models
  • High­est num­ber of Tes­las: 4,260
  • High­est num­ber of Nis­sans: 955
  • High­est num­ber of Chevro­lets: 4,250
  • High­est num­ber of BMWs: 423
  • High­est num­ber of Mit­subishis: 179
  • High­est num­ber of Aud­is: 165
  • High­est num­ber of Fords: 104
  • High­est num­ber of Volvos: 87
  • High­est num­ber of Min­is: 67

Boulder County

  • 8,260 elec­tric vehi­cles (6,118 BEVs and 2,142 PHEVs)
  • 84 EV models
  • High­est num­ber of Tes­las: 2,920
  • High­est num­ber of Nis­sans: 1,993
  • High­est num­ber of Toy­otas: 427
  • High­est num­ber of BMWs: 319
  • High­est num­ber of Chevro­lets: 284
  • High­est num­ber of Fords: 110
  • High­est num­ber of Hyundais: 110
  • High­est num­ber of Volk­swa­gens: 102
  • High­est num­ber of Fiats: 76

Jefferson County

  • 6,870 elec­tric vehi­cles (4,922 BEVs and 1,948 PHEVs)
  • 84 EV models
  • High­est num­ber of Tes­las: 2,881
  • High­est num­ber of Nis­sans: 916
  • High­est num­ber of Chevro­lets: 283
  • High­est num­ber of Toy­otas: 277
  • High­est num­ber of Fords: 137
  • High­est num­ber of Aud­is: 118
  • High­est num­ber of Hon­das: 50

Arapahoe County

  • 6,117 elec­tric vehi­cles (4,485 BEVs and 1,632 PHEVs)
  • 85 EV models
  • High­est num­ber of Tes­las: 2,824
  • High­est num­ber of Nis­sans: 694
  • High­est num­ber of BMWs: 320
  • High­est num­ber of Kias: 261
  • High­est num­ber of Toy­otas: 183
